How To Fix FAGL_SKF029 - Select a valid version


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: FAGL_SKF - Statistical Key Figures (General Part)

  • Message number: 029

  • Message text: Select a valid version

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    The only versions specified for ledger &V1& and company code &V2& either
    do not exist or are not posted in the combination of ledger &V1& and
    company code &V2&.

    System Response

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
